What goods and services does Canada import and export?

Goods Exported consists of raw materials such as lumber, fish, and minerals. Semi-manufactured goods such as automotive parts or electronic components. Manufactured goods such as cameras, clothes, and toys. Services are activities that individuals, groups, organizations, or companies perform to advise others. Some examples of exported services would be banks, insurance firms, telecommunications companies, water and electricity suppliers, translators, housekeepers etc. Canada imports necessary items like fruits/vegetables, crude petroleum, energy products, metals, chemicals, plastics, aircraft machinery, cars and car parts.
